Disengagement of troops starts near Bohdanivka and Petrivske in Donetsk region

Ukrainian military and Russian-occupation troops have started to withdraw forces and hardware near the village of Bohdanivka in Donetsk region after signal rockets were launched.

 “White rockets were launched at 12:01, green rockets were launched at 12:15 and the equipment began to move at 12:20. Our equipment – one armored vehicle and one Ural vehicle – and seven personnel members began to occupy positions previously defined within the framework of disengagement. Tomorrow and the day after tomorrow, the servicepersons and the military equipment will be withdrawn,” head of the JFO press center Andriy Aheev informed.

He also said that the Ukrainian side had received confirmation from the OSCE SMM monitors staying in the uncontrolled territory about the launch of rockets and the beginning of withdrawal by militants.

As reported, the disengagement of troops in the area of ​​Bohdanivka and Petrivske localities in Donetsk region, scheduled for November 4, was postponed due to the attacks on positions of the Joint Forces which had been recorded on October 30.

On November 8, the Ukrainian side announced its readiness to start the practical process of the disengagement of forces and hardware at the aforementioned site No. 3 at 12:00. At the same time, Russian-occupation troops announced that they would start disengagement on their side only on November 9.

Special Representative of the OSCE Chairperson-in-Office in Ukraine and in the Trilateral Contact Group, Ambassador Martin Sajdik stated that the Trilateral Contact Group, with the participation of representatives of certain areas of Donetsk and Luhansk regions of Ukraine, agreed on the date and time of the start of the renewed withdrawal of forces and hardware from the disengagement area of Petrivske on Saturday, 9 November 2019, at 12:00 Kyiv time.

On November 8, the JFO Headquarters released the statement on the disruption of disengagement of troops in the area of Bohdanivka and Petrivske by militants.
